Understanding Impact Adapter Challenges: Why Traditional Tools Fall Short

Anyone who's worked on automotive repairs, home renovations, or industrial equipment knows the frustration of trying to reach fasteners in tight, confined spaces. You've probably been there yourself – awkwardly contorting your body, desperately trying to get enough leverage on a bolt that's just out of comfortable reach. According to a recent survey of professional mechanics, nearly 68% identify limited access as their biggest challenge during complex repairs.

Traditional socket adapters compound this problem with their bulky design. The extra height they add to your tool setup can mean the difference between a simple job and an absolute nightmare. In fact, industry data shows that mechanics spend an average of 22 minutes per repair just figuring out how to access difficult fasteners. That's time and money wasted on what should be straightforward tasks.

The Real Cost of Inadequate Tools

Professional mechanics lose an estimated 2-3 hours per week wrestling with fasteners in tight spaces, translating to approximately $7,800 in lost annual revenue for the average repair shop.

Standard adapters present several critical challenges:

  • Excessive Height: Adding unnecessary length that prevents access in cramped areas
  • Connection Instability: Poor fitment leading to wobbling and potential tool slippage
  • Material Weaknesses: Substandard metals that can't withstand high-torque applications
  • Storage Inefficiency: Loose pieces that get lost in toolboxes or drawers

But the problems don't end there. When working on expensive machinery or vehicles, the risk of damaging surrounding components increases dramatically when you're struggling with inadequate tools. I've personally witnessed countless instances where technicians have scratched finishes, cracked plastic components, or even injured themselves trying to compensate for poor adapter access.

The automotive repair industry in particular feels this pain acutely. With modern vehicles packing increasingly complex components into tighter engine compartments, the demand for specialized, space-saving tools has never been higher. A shocking 73% of mechanics report having to remove additional components just to access fasteners that could be reached directly with the right adapter tool.
